Monument restoration - Right and Beautiful
21/07/2025 11:19
“Up to now, nearly 200 works and items within the Complex of Hue Monuments have been preserved, restored, and renovated, with a total expense of over 2.000 billion VND. This work has always strictly complied with the regulations of the 1972 World Heritage Convention, UNESCO guidelines, and the Law on Cultural Heritage of Vietnam, ensuring authenticity, integrity, and adaptability to the harsh climate conditions of the Central region of Vietnam, etc.,”. These details were shared by Hue Monuments Conservation Center to Mr. Lazare Eloundou, Director of UNESCO Cultural Heritage Center during his visit and working trip in Vietnam at the end of May.
